Mumbai, Sept. 25 -- Reserve Bank of India (RBI) stated in its latest monthly bulletin that amidst surplus liquidity, the weighted average call rate- the operating target of monetary policy, generally hovered in the lower half of the corridor in August and the first half of September. However, it hardened during September 15-19 as system liquidity moderated on account of tax outflows. Overnight rates in the collateralised segment- the triparty and market repo - and the benchmark secured overnight rupee rate largely moved in tandem with the uncollateralised rate.
